8.数据库探测方法

来源:互联网 发布:英语听力复读软件 编辑:程序博客网 时间:2024/05/19 12:28

【小迪实地培训——扫盲篇】

 

【如何判断数据库】

1.根据脚本语言

Asp access 小部分搭mssql(sql server)

Php mysql

Aspx mssql(sql server) 一小部分搭mysql

Jsp oracle

 

 

2.根据报错信息获得

 

‘ @#%

他这种很明显是access数据库

 

Mysql报错界面

每一种数据库,报错的话有可能会显示数据库信息。

 

 

 

3.扫描端口获取

Mysql 3306

Mssql 14331434

Oracle 1521

可以通过扫目标站的端口,如果1433开放,基本可以确定是mssql(sql server)数据库。如果3306开放,基本可以确定是mysql数据库。以此类推。

 

 

比如mysql3306端口被修改为33306,如果是不可疑端口。2653

可以用:xx.xx.xx.xx: 2653  IP+端口访问,如果是数据库端口,也会显示出数据库信息(大部分)

 

端口修改就扫端口,逐个访问,如果是数据库端口,会返回版本或数据库名

 

 

总结:

小型站点一般就是access

数据量多的站点,即使是asp脚本,一般也不是access

Access数据库特点,

正常网站使用,数据达到100M 就会出现数据交互卡 慢。

论坛使用,数据达到50M 就会很卡,很慢。

原创粉丝点击